Eat. Pace. Plan

Published on: 5th December 2018

This festive period we want Londoners to have a good time, eat drink and be merry but also to stay safe and not ruin their night. Now we are not telling people not to drink and enjoy themselves – we all love a party - but we can also all recall a time when someone has maybe had a few too many.

Last December 5,526 incidents the London Ambulance Service attended were alcohol related. Look after your friends and colleagues this year and stick to safer drinking levels. If it's your office Christmas party, or you're just going out with friends or family, remember to plan your journey home in advance, check the train or bus times and only use licensed taxi cabs. Don’t just think about how to get there; think about how you will get home.

Put some extra thought and plans in place for a safer more enjoyable night out. Have a safe and merry Christmas!
